In this line, the Machu Travel Foundation is a non-profit organization created in 2015 in Cusco – Peru, as part of the social commitment of Machu Travel Peru Company. The Foundation develops social sports projects through comprehensive support for talented mountain bikers with limited financial resources of the Cusco tourism zones and their surroundings.

The direct support consists of economic maintenance, provision of sports equipment, training classes and practices, and subsidy in the registration of national and international championships. All this is to promote sports and good habits.

SANTISIMO DOWNHILL 2024 IN CUSCO, A SPECIAL OCCASION THAT GATHERED THE BEST BIKERS IN THE WORLD

Santisimo Downhill 2024

One of Peru’s most emblematic downhill mountain bike races, the Santisimo Downhill Challenge, returned to Cusco after seven years. Of course, the event in the Imperial City was unique, as the competition celebrated its 10th edition there.

The 2.4-kilometer circuit started at Salvidachayoc Hill’s viewpoint in the San Isidro Chicón community district in the province of Urubamba, Cusco, at 3548 m.a.s.l. The finish point was the stadium of the same community, over the intersection of the local road with Av Mariscal Castilla, in the Center of Urubamba, at 3127 m.a.s.l. 

The race route in the Sacred Valley of the Incas, a unique blend of natural and artificial obstacles, spanned approximately 2.4 kilometers. With its challenging course featuring around 421 meters of unevenness, it was a true test of skill and endurance. The proximity to the snow-capped Chicón added an element of unpredictability, with the threat of rain looming over the competition days of April 20 and 21. However, the route’s sandy, stony, non-clay gravel soil was designed naturally to handle such conditions, ensuring a smooth and exciting race. 

The Santisimo Downhill Challenge is not just a local event; it’s a beacon of extreme downhill bike sports in Latin America. The quality of national and international participants is a testament to its prestige and recognition. More than 100 bikers participated in this famous challenge, including locals Brener Montes, Mateo Negri, and Lucio Vellutino.

They ensured that the house was respected in the face of true glories of the world downhill, such as the Ecuadorians Andrés Sotomayor and Iker Sotomayor, who have several international titles, or the current World Champion, Mario Jarrin. Without mentioning the Argentine Gonzalo Gajdosech, who is currently considered one of the best in South America. 

As if that were not enough, the Italian rider Eleonora Farina participated in this race, who is in the world ranking and has 4 medals in the European Mountain Bike Championship. In addition, the Santísimo had to New Zealander Tuhoto Ariki, ranked worldwide and recognized in 2023 as “King of Crankworx Whistler” 

The competition was a full-blown party where competition and fraternity always reigned. And where organizers, collaborators, and participants were winners. The organizer’s objective, Diego Seminario, together with strategic collaborators such as Machu Travel Peru, is clear: Position this circuit as one of the dates of the downhill world championship shortly, and it seems that they are achieving it!

COMMUNITY OF SALKANTAY
LOCATION: CUSCO - SANTA TERESA DISTRICT - LA CONVENCION PROVINCE

A rural community close to Cusco, that suffers from poverty the same as any community in the Highlands, that has no electricity or drinking water, with a small shop and public school that has only one teacher who must educate more than 50 children from different levels.

Towns such as these need our support. And Machu Travel Peru brought a little joy, hot chocolate and panettone to these children for Christmas 2014.

COMMUNITY OF MISMINAY
LOCATION: CUSCO - MARAS DISTRICT - VALLE SAGRADO

In the community of Misminay, Cusco, there are 300 families who live and preserve their ancient traditions in harmony with nature and the belief in the cosmos.

In this remarkable village, which possesses mysterious textile iconography, unique plants and animals, and subtle gastronomy of native products, their pre-Hispanic customs are maintained. And, the best is that they share their traditions and customs with the foreign visitor.

Machu Travel Peru had the honor of sharing pleasant moments with the people of Misminay at Christmas 2013, an unforgettable experience!
